The admins have been analysing the events from all the races, as we
traveled to Estoril for the opener, to Lime Rock to finally the night race of Montreal.
We have been observing the race ethic and driving characteristics of all the
drivers who competed in Season 2 of the SRCA.
We are more strict starting from this season and onwards, ensuring only the
drivers with the highest driving standards can race in a higher series.
Only the drivers with these highest driving standard will be allow a License
4 after only 1 season of the Academy. More than one season will become normal
to see drivers develop into VEC standard. This has been achieved by using a
new more strict License points system, which was tested and used in season 2.
The number of points each driver receives (per race and overall) will not be
revealed nor will the total number needed. Only whether each driver has managed
to gather enough to achieve a license 4. Ensuring only the type of drivers
which Simracing.club's higher series wishes to see race, get a license 4
(whether they race 2 or 3 races).
These results are final and effective immediately. If you feel you have been
placed wrongly please feel free to prove us wrong by racing the best you can,
these strict rules are for the benefit of all the drivers. It is a learning
programme, please just treat it as such.
As you are all aware you currently have License 5, this only allows you
to compete in SCRA, therefore please do not apply to look for a drive in
another series until you have at least license 4.
